Swedish interior designer Lotta Agaton founded her Stockholm-based Lotta Agaton Studios in 2004. Since then, her distinctive, multi-disciplinary style has become one of the progenitors of the contemporary Scandinavian soft minimalist aesthetic. Agaton is the co-founder of Residence Magazine, cementing her as an influential force in the world of interior design and a master of visual communication.
For Ark Kollekt 03, Agaton has curated a selection that brings together tableware and her own approach to styling. This partnership is ideal for the holiday season, showing us that a holiday table can reflect our personal stylistic expression in a way that feels authentic to both the time of year and ourselves.
“My curation is divided in two parts: one is a mix of minimalist and graphic objects in natural materials such as ceramic, stone, and wood. This style and these kind of objects are my base in everything I do. Then I like to mix that neutral base with bold and unique objects that brings personality and contrast; that is my second part of my selections for Ark Kollekt,” explains Lotta.
